Hello Neighbor 2 Beta: Investigating the Mysterious "Beta 1.1" Experience

The journey of Hello Neighbor 2 from its early prototypes to its full release on December 6, 2022, was a rollercoaster of community-driven hype and evolving AI technology. Among its various development builds, the Hello Neighbor 2 Beta remains a significant milestone for fans who wanted an early, "spoiler-free" look at Raven Brooks.

Specifically, the search for a "Beta 11" often leads players to the Beta 1.1 update, which was the primary technical refinement released during the official closed beta period in mid-2022. What was the Hello Neighbor 2 Beta?

The Beta was described as an "encapsulated experience" designed to show off the game's shift toward an open-world format. Unlike the first game’s single-house focus, the Beta allowed players to explore a semi-open town filled with various AI-driven residents, each powered by a neural network that supposedly learned from player behaviors. Release Date: April 7, 2022.

Access: Primarily restricted to players who pre-ordered the game on Steam, Xbox, or PlayStation.

Protagonist: You play as Quentin, a journalist investigating the disappearance of children in Raven Brooks.

Antagonist: This was the first downloadable version where Mr. Peterson (the original Neighbor) returned as the main antagonist, replacing "The Guest" from earlier Alphas. Key Features of the Beta 1.1 Update

This version was more than just a bug fix; it was a "proof of concept" for the advanced neural network AI that would eventually power the full game. Adaptive Intelligence

: Unlike the first game's scripted encounters, the Beta 1.1 AI actively tracked and adapted to player behavior in real-time across the neighborhood. The "Baker" Update

: One of the most unique additions in this version was the refined behavior of the Baker. Patch notes revealed she was given the ability to "properly get rid of items" and correctly stash keys in cabinets, making the bakery puzzles significantly more dynamic. Technical Stability

: It addressed critical immersion-breaking issues, such as the Mayor getting stuck in infinite "door-opening" loops and fixing the lightpoles to illuminate the town correctly during the day/night cycle.

Hello Neighbor 2 Beta 1.1 " (often referred to as version 1.1) was a significant update to the closed beta released in June 2022. It was an "exclusive" build available primarily to those who pre-ordered the game before its full release in December 2022. Beta 1.1 Key Highlights Release Date: June 21, 2022.

Purpose: This update focused on fixing major progression-breaking bugs, refining cutscenes, and improving the "self-learning AI" that adapts to player behavior. Gameplay Changes:

AI Navigation: Improved NPC reactions; for example, the AI can now hear footsteps more clearly when you walk or sprint nearby.

Exploration: The beta allows players to explore a large portion of Raven Brooks, including multiple houses with suspicious residents, rather than just one house.

Security Tweaks: Speedrunners' exploits (like entering through specific windows) were patched, and certain items like boards could no longer be taken from their designated spots. How to Access/Download (PC) Summarize what Hello Neighbor 2 is and what
